Promotions: Math Problems in Disguise
Take a £100 welcome package that promises 200% match plus 100 free spins. In reality you must wager 30× the bonus, meaning £600 of turnover before you can even think of withdrawing. That’s a 600% hidden cost, a figure you won’t find in the glossy brochure.
